Entiteiten

Zamel is fundamenteel een grote database. Zoals elke database bestaat Zamel uit ellenlange lijsten met informatie. Om een beetje structuur te brengen werd alle informatie of data opgedeeld in verschillende types, genaamd entiteiten. Voorbeelden van entiteiten zijn contacten, activiteiten, inschrijvingen, facturen, betalingen, ...

Eigenschappen van entiteiten:

  • hebben één of meerder velden. Bij sommige entiteiten kan je zelf vrij velden toevoegen.

  • sommige entiteiten hebben subtypes.

  • zijn vrij doorzoekbaar en op te lijsten.

  • als we een item toevoegen aan een specifieke entiteit, we maken bijvoorbeeld een nieuw contact aan, dan is dit een record.

  • records onder elke entiteit hebben steeds een label, een id, een datum van creatie en laatste update en de gebruiker van de creatie en de laatste update.

Om de terminologie wat beter te duiden, kunnen we een entiteit best vergelijken met een Excel Sheet. Een lijst in Excel definieert welke data we bewaren (bijvoorbeeld onze lijst met contacten). Als we een lijn toevoegen in deze lijst dan heet dit een record (in dit voorbeeld 1 specifiek contact). De velden in Zamel tot slot, stemmen overeen met de kolommen in onze Excel (bijvoorbeeld voornaam, achternaam).

Last updated